The Scottish Roots of Kyle Red Silverstein

The "Kyle" part of Kyle Red Silverstein, it seems, has its roots quite firmly planted in Scottish soil. This name, you know, comes from what we call a surname, a family name used to tell one group of people apart from another. These surnames often came from where people lived, or perhaps what they did for a living, or even a particular trait they possessed. For Kyle, the connection to place is quite strong, apparently.

There are, as a matter of fact, specific locations in Scotland that share this name. One that comes to mind is Kyle, a place in Ayrshire, along the southwest coast of Scotland. So, it's not just a word; it's a real spot on the map, a place with its own history and landscape. This connection means that the name carries a sense of that particular area, a feeling of the Scottish coast, you know, with its unique features.

A Narrow Channel - The Meaning of Kyle Red Silverstein

When we look at the meaning behind the "Kyle" in Kyle Red Silverstein, we find ourselves thinking about specific geographical features. The word itself, you know, comes from the Gaelic language, an old tongue spoken in parts of Scotland and Ireland. In Gaelic, the word is "caol," and it has a very particular meaning that paints a picture of the landscape, apparently.

"Caol" refers to something that is narrow. It can mean a narrow stretch of water, like a sound or a strait, where two larger bodies of water come close together, forming a passage. Or, it might point to a narrow piece of land, a thin strip that juts out into the water, perhaps connecting two larger landmasses or simply extending from the coast. This is, you know, a very descriptive kind of word.

So, the name Kyle, at its core, carries this idea of a confined space, a passage, or a slender form. It’s a concept tied to the physical shape of the land and water. This meaning gives the name a certain clarity, a sense of being well-defined, which is quite interesting. It suggests a connection to places where the land or water narrows, creating a distinct boundary or pathway, you know, in a way.
